Final Fantasy XIII keeps looking better every trailer. I can’t wait to get my hands on this game, it’s going to be one long night once I get it. The trailer shows a barrage of scenes from the videogame and a backing track of a matching love son. All I gotta say is,  Final Fantasy needs to put some Hikari Utada.